#a3611d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a3611d is composed of 63.9% red, 38%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.5%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#a3611d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c23a with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a3611d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a3611d has RGB values of R:163, G:97,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.82,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10707229.

Shades and Tints of #a3611d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0802 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a3611d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61605f is the less saturated color, while #b96107 is the most saturated one.
